Where is Surat Thani?
Where is Surat Thani located?
Surat Thani, Surat Thani, Thailand (approx. 9.1404136°, 99.3241347°)
Where is Surat Thani on the map?
Surat Thani - Siem Reap
Surat Thani - Kaarst IKEA
Surat Thani - Kuala Lumpur
Surat Thani - El Jadida
Surat Thani - Singapore
Surat Thani - Bangkok
Surat Thani - Cheow Lan Lake
Surat Thani - Chiang Mai
Surat Thani - Don Sak
Surat Thani - Khao Sok National Park
Surat Thani - Krabi
Surat Thani - Phuket
Surat Thani - Ratchaprapa Dam
Surat Thani - Surat Thani Train station
Surat Thani - Novodeviche
{"latitude":9.1404136,"longitude":99.3241347,"title":"Surat Thani"}